2009-12-02 24 views
12

Estoy tratando de ejecutar un trabajo cron para que un script php se ejecute cada 10 minutos en mi servidor. El script actualiza una base de datos. En este momento mi crontab se ve así:php cron job cada 10 minutos

* /10 * * * * /usr/bin/php /home/user/public_html/domain.com/private/update.php 

Sin embargo, la secuencia de comandos php parece que nunca se ejecuta. También he intentado volver a cargar cron después de actualizar la ficha cron con:

$ /etc/init.d/cron reload 

pero esto no funcionaba bien. ¿Mi crontab actual se ve correctamente formateado? ¿Hay permisos específicos que se deben especificar en un archivo para poder ejecutar un script?

+3

Esta debería ser una pregunta de superuser.com – Graviton

Respuesta

33

No debe haber un espacio entre "*" y "/ 10". Debería ser:

*/10 * * * * /usr/bin/php /home/user/public_html/domain.com/private/update.php 
Cuestiones relacionadas